Bus Hire in Karlovy Vary

Karlovy Vary (Carlsbad) is the Czech Republic's most famous spa town, its colonnaded promenades, Hot Spring Colonnade, and ornate Victorian hydro hotels set in a wooded valley on the Ohre and Tepla rivers. The 13 hot mineral springs have drawn European aristocracy and celebrities for five centuries. Since 1946, the city also hosts the Karlovy Vary International Film Festival (KVIFF), one of the oldest and most respected in the world.

The town itself is walkable and compact, though the approach roads are narrow. Full-size coaches are restricted in the inner valley; we plan routes using the designated coach parking areas on the valley rim and, where needed, smaller minibuses for the final approach to the colonnades.

Spa Colonnades and Hot Springs

The Mill Colonnade (Mlynska kolonada), the Market Colonnade, and the Hot Spring Colonnade (Vridelni kolonada) are the centrepieces of Karlovy Vary. Groups visit to drink from the mineral springs (served in traditional spa cups), walk the Tepla river promenade, and take in the Belle Epoque hotel facades. Coaches park at the Becherplatz area on the valley edge; the colonnade walk is 10 minutes on foot.

Karlovy Vary International Film Festival

The KVIFF (late June to early July) is one of the world's oldest film festivals and attracts celebrity attendees and film industry groups. The Grand Hotel Pupp and the Thermal Hotel are the main festival venues. Film-industry delegate transfers from Prague (130 km east) and Frankfurt (280 km north-west) are common during the festival.

Becherovka Distillery

The Jan Becher Museum and distillery on T.G. Masaryka Namesti offers guided group tours of the historic Becherovka herbal bitter production. The distillery has been producing the liqueur since 1807 and the tour includes a tasting session. This is a popular addition for incentive travel groups.

What Bus Hire Costs in Karlovy Vary

As a rough guide, a minibus (up to 19 seats) in Karlovy Vary runs around 5,500-9,800 CZK per day, a midi-coach (around 35 seats) around 9,200-16,500 CZK per day, and a full-size coach (49 to 55 seats) around 13,800-24,500 CZK per day. Film festival period (late June to early July) commands premium pricing; book at least 12 weeks ahead for KVIFF dates.
